Paul and Eyring, Edward M. and Huai, Huaying", title = "Photoacoustic Enhancement of Surface IR Modes in Zeolite Channels", journal = "Applied Spectroscopy", volume = "45", number = "5", year = "1991", abstract = "The photoacoustic (PA) signal enhancement of an infrared-active mode of the adsorbed pyridine in the channel/cage of zeolites HZSM-5 and HY was studied comparatively with the use of photoacoustic, transmittance, and diffuse reflectance FT-IR spectroscopies. The data indicate that the PA enhancements of an infrared band of the adsorbed pyridine in the channel/cage of HY and HZSM-5 are 2.1 and 3.3, respectively. The importance of interstitial gas expansion in the photoacoustic signal enhancement of the surface infrared mode is discussed.", pages = "883-885", url = "http://www.ingentaconnect.com/content/sas/sas/1991/00000045/00000005/art00023", doi = "doi:10.1366/0003702914336499", keyword = "Infrared, Photoacoustics, Zeolites" }
